One Week Remains until World Standards Week 2008



Only one week remains before the U.S. standards and conformity assessment community comes together for World Standards Week 2008 (WSW), which will be held in Bethesda, MD from October 20-23, 2008.

Hosted annually by the American National Standards Institute (ANSI), WSW brings together members of the diverse U.S. standardization community, fostering a spirit of collaboration and celebration for a series of forums, meetings, and ceremonies.

This year's week-long series of events will include meetings of several ANSI groups and committees: the Patent Group, the International Policy Committee, the Intellectual Property Rights Policy Committee, and the Copyright Group. A number of fora will also meet during WSW 2008, including: the Company Member Forum, the Consumer Interest Forum, the Legal Issues Forum, the Joint Member Forum, the Organizational Member Forum, and the Government Member Forum.

Several members of the standards and conformity assessment community will be recognized for their achievements at the 2008 ANSI Awards Banquet and Ceremony, another element of the WSW series of events. ANSI's annual leadership and service awards program is a long-standing tradition that recognizes and honors the creativity, dedication and vision of those individuals who contribute to and participate in U.S. and global voluntary standards-setting and conformity assessment activities. Sixteen distinguished award recipients will be honored during the ceremony, which will be held on Wednesday, October 22.

The Annual Business Meeting and Luncheon will be held on Thursday, October 23. The meeting will marry an overview of ANSI's current pursuits and milestones with a celebration of the Institute's 90th anniversary, bringing the ANSI's past and future to the table in a discussion of the organization's growth and progress.

Also on Thursday will be the U.S. Celebration of World Standards Day (WSD), an evening exhibition, reception, and dinner that celebrate the standardization community with a focus on this year's theme, Intelligent and Sustainable Buildings. [see related article]
